\n\nResponsibilities:\n
  • Be a Supportive Guide : Assess and communicate psychosocial status to the RN Case Manager and interdisciplinary group.
  • Connect Hearts and Homes: Evaluate medical needs, home situations, financial resources, and community support.
  • Provide Individualized Care Advocacy: Implement personalized social work plans and collaborate with your Bereavement Coordinator.
  • Be part of a United Team Effort: Shape care plans, attend interdisciplinary meetings, and address psychosocial stresses.
  • Provide Counseling with Compassion: Provide empathetic counseling to patients and families.
\n\nQualifications:\n
  • Masters of Social Work from an accredited school of social work
  • Minimum one (1) year experience as a social worker in long term care or medical surgical/acute care setting. Hospice exp a PLUS!
  • Possess and maintains current CPR certification if required by state.
